In the iOS modding community, developers often tweak official apps using tools like injected dynamic libraries (dylibs). Modified versions of popular apps (like YouTube or Spotify) frequently succeed because those platforms offer a free, ad-supported tier. Developers can modify the app's code to hide ads or enable background playback.
